Tio Fanta Pinem is a renowned Indonesian pop singer, born on March 17, 1964, in Sidikalang, North Sumatra. He is known for his distinctive voice and has been successful with his album "Tiada Nama Seindah Namamu," released in the mid-1980s. Tio Fanta Pinem is also celebrated for singing traditional folk songs from various regions, including Karo, Batak Toba, Pakpak, and Timor. His music often reflects the cultural heritage of his native North Sumatra. In addition to his music career, he has been involved in politics, running for vice regent of Dairi in 2008.
Tio Fanta Pinem's music spans genres like Indo Pop and traditional folk, with recent releases including collaborations with Jhonny S Manurung and albums like "Cantik Manis" and "Pop Rohani Karo." His contributions to the Indonesian music scene have made him a beloved figure, especially in the Karo tribe community, where he is admired as a diva with a unique and melodious voice.
